Output bc7cae33a44d2a8a6eff803b9da9f51e1209a919a04bbc34bc5f50976ad8109a:0

value
8000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66c69285e421b3d06c09fbff7156debc2243008 OP_EQUAL
address
3MEnQ7DU9PtMdQ1FVwkxMhnS24afwcKfqn
transaction
bc7cae33a44d2a8a6eff803b9da9f51e1209a919a04bbc34bc5f50976ad8109a
spent
true